Senior Photonics Engineer

Bristol area, onsite role – Permanent opportunity – Competitive salary and generous benefits package

About the programme.

Our client is a UK sovereign defence engineering company delivering a novel counter-UAS capability for MOD, NATO, and allied customers.

The programme is founder-led, moves at startup pace, and is genuinely differentiated from prime-tier defence engineering — smaller teams, faster decisions, and real ownership for senior engineers.

Our client combines internal engineering delivery with partnerships across the UK's photonics and defence research community, and the role advertised here sits at the intersection of those two worlds.

About the role.

Our client is hiring a Senior Photonics Engineer to represent the company as a long-term embedded member of a leading UK photonics research group in the M4 corridor / South West England area.

The successful candidate joins our client as a permanent employee but is based five days a week with the research partner, working on advanced photonics research relevant to our client's defence programme.

Regular visits to the main research laboratory to maintain integration with the wider engineering team.

The horizon is genuinely long-term, becoming our client's in-house authority in this technology area as internal capability builds.

About the person we're looking for.

Mid-career industry engineer, 5-15 years post-graduation, with genuine hands-on photonics and laser heritage.

Essentials: excellent interpersonal communication skills, prior experience working with lasers and setting up free-space optical systems, and strong understanding of light guidance principles including optical modes.

Desirable: prior experience with high-power lasers, experience in optical fibre fabrication, and prior R&D industry experience.

Industry-shaped rather than pure academic — comfortable operating in a research environment on advanced technologies while remaining industry-employed.

Long-term commitment mindset.

Genuinely engaged with UK sovereign defence engineering as a mission.

Package competitive at mid-career photonics engineering level, nationwide search with relocation allowance available for the right candidate.

Start before Christmas 2026 is the target.
